Now, would this improvement in latency be noticeable for streaming games from your computer in your bedroom to your htpc in your living room? I have no idea, but would be very fun to test. :)
In the home you will have higher latency in the TVs processing than in the network.
100Mbit/s might be enough for any h264 encoded stream (that is the most common encoder you might find inside any phone SOC or GPU). Blurays are encoded I think at max 40Mbit/s. Even using extra bandwidth instead extra processing cycles to have better quality, I wonder if you ever would need more than 60Mbit/s.
